为了比较不同电信级以太网(CE)技术方案的优劣,文章依据城域以太网论坛(MEF)定义的电信级以太网的特点,针对可扩展性、可靠性、服务质量(QoS)、业务承载能力以及业务管理等方面描述了相应的测试方案。通过实际的测试可以看到,目前的电信级以太网技术在以上几个方面均能基本满足电信级组网的需求。但是,由于不同的电信级以太网解决方案在业务承载能力、可靠性、扩展能力、服务质量(QoS)以及运营管理维护(OAM)能力方面存在着较大的差异性,在短期内难以实现完全的互联互通。
In order to compare the effectiveness of different Carrier Ethernet (CE) technologies, test methods are described based on the features of CE defined by Metro Ethernet Forum (MEF), including scalability testing, reliability testing, Quality of Service (QoS) testing, service bearer capability testing and service management testing, etc. It can be seen from the test results that the present CE technologies could satisfy basic requirements of carrier-class network on the abovementioned aspects. However, complete interconnection could hardly be achieved between different CE solution projects in the short term because of major diversities, existing in those projects on the aspects of service bearer capability, reliability, scalability, QoS and Operation Administration and Maintenance (OAM) ability.
